02 Deal signals
Retail stickers are percussion. The fine print is the rhythm. Use these checks to compare an offer on its real value.
01 / BASELINE
Compare the usual selling price—not the crossed-out MSRP. A discount only matters when the baseline is honest.
02 / BUNDLE
Thrones, pedals, sticks, cables, and stands add value only when they fit your setup and quality bar.
03 / CONDITION
Demo, open-box, and blemished gear can be excellent buys. Confirm warranty, missing parts, and return terms first.
04 / TOTAL
Shipping, tax, adapters, heads, mounting hardware, and protection can turn a cheap kit into an expensive setup.

The shell-game check
Look beyond lacquer. Bearing edges, shell roundness, lug condition, included mounts, and sturdy stands determine whether a shell pack is gig-ready.
The ecosystem check
Pad feel matters, but inputs, sample expansion, hi-hat support, USB audio, and replacement-part availability determine how far an e-kit can grow.
The voice check
Pre-packs save money when every voice fits. Listen for weight, sustain, pitch spread, and whether the ride and hats suit the music you actually play.
